1.創建DOM元素 createElement(標簽名) 創建一個節點 appendChild(節點) 追加一個節點 例子:為ul插入li 並且為li元素插入一些文字 效果: appendChild(節點) 追加一個節點,每次都在尾部追加 ...
在firefox, webkit中我們可以使用DOMNodeInsertedIntoDocument事件,但這個事件很快變廢棄了,雖然瀏覽器還是很有節操地支持它們,但哪一天不在也很難說。比如說firefox 已經不支持了,IE則始終不支持此事件。 這里有個腳本,可以判定瀏覽器是否支持變動事件 var mutations function document C WebReflection Mit S ...
2013-07-15 21:24 1 3263 推薦指數:
1.創建DOM元素 createElement(標簽名) 創建一個節點 appendChild(節點) 追加一個節點 例子:為ul插入li 並且為li元素插入一些文字 效果: appendChild(節點) 追加一個節點,每次都在尾部追加 ...
我們在閱讀JS高級程序設計的時候,提到了節點樹的概念。比如說: elem.parentNode---找elem的父節點; elem.childNodes---找elem的所有的直接子節點; elem.nextSibling---找elem的下一個同輩節點 ...
一、結點 文檔對象模型(Document Object Model),是W3C組織推薦的處理可擴展標記語言的標准編程接口。js的DOM操作可以改變網頁的內容、結構和樣式,可以利用DOM操作來改變元素里面的內容、屬性等。 1、html的DOM樹 上面的HTML文件可以轉化 ...
相信很多初學前端的小伙伴,學了html, css, js之后,欣喜之余還有一絲小傲嬌,沒有想到那些大佬們口中又 提到了DOM樹。 你兩眼一抹黑,年輕人總是要接受社會的愛(du)護(da)。 DOM 是 Document Object Model(文檔對象模型)的縮寫。 為了那些被dom支配 ...
選擇樹 概念:假設有k個已經排序的序列,並且想要將其合並成一個單獨的排序序列。每個排好序的序列叫走一個歸並段。 暴力算法:假設總共有n個數字,每次取k個歸並串最小或者最大的一個數,比較k-1次得到所有數中最大或者最小的樹,存入新空間中,接着一直這樣比較...需要比較的次數是n ...
選擇樹 概念:假設有k個已經排序的序列,並且想要將其合並成一個單獨的排序序列。每個排好序的序列叫走一個歸並段。 暴力算法:假設總共有n個數字,每次取k個歸並串最小或者最大的一個數,比較k-1次得到所有數中最大或者最小的樹,存入新空間中,接着一直這樣比較...需要比較的次數是n ...
一般情況下CSS不會直接影響JS的程序邏輯,但是以CSS實現動畫的話,這個便不太確定了,這個故事發生在與UED遷移全局樣式的過程。 曾經我有一段實現彈出層隱藏動畫的代碼是這個樣子的: ...